What are Headshots?

In Free Fire, headshots are the ultimate technique for swiftly eliminating opponents. Landing a single, well-aimed headshot can instantly knock down an enemy, giving you a crucial edge in battle. Mastering this skill involves optimizing settings, employing effective techniques, and practicing consistently.

The sensitivity settings in Free Fire are vital for enhancing your aim's speed and precision. By fine-tuning these settings, you can improve your character's movement and tracking capabilities, particularly when aiming for headshots. Utilizing the right Free Fire headshot settings can significantly increase your chances of landing those critical shots without resorting to hacks or additional tools.

Best Sensitivity Settings for Headshots

Sensitivity settings are key to refining your aim, especially for headshots. Adjusting these settings ensures your crosshair moves smoothly and accurately.

Best Settings for Easier Headshots in Free Fire

Here are some recommended settings to optimize your headshot game:

  • Aim Precision: Set to default
  • Left Fire Button: Always
  • Reload Progress on Crosshair: Off
  • Hold Fire to Scope: On
  • Grenade Slot: Double Slot
  • Vehicle Controls: Two-handed
  • Auto-parachute: On
  • Quick Weapon Switch: On
  • Quick Reload: Off
  • Run Mode: Classic
  • Free Look: On

Optimize your HUD Layout

Your control layout, or HUD, is another essential aspect of improving your gameplay. A personalized setup tailored to your playstyle can significantly enhance your performance.

  • Fire Button Placement: Position the fire button where your thumb can comfortably reach it. Many professional players opt for a three-finger or four-finger claw setup for enhanced control.
  • Drag Shooting: Enable the "drag shoot" technique by setting your fire button size between 50-70%. A larger button facilitates precise swiping for headshots.
  • Quick Weapon Switch: Place the weapon switch button close to your thumb for swift access, ensuring you're always ready to aim for the head.
  • Crouch and Jump Buttons: Position these buttons near your movement controls to effectively execute crouch + shoot and jump + shoot techniques.
  • Scope Button: Keep the scope button near your index finger for quick aiming and better headshot alignment.

Increase your Headshot Accuracy Using BlueStacks Tools

While mobile screens are great for navigating the game's terrain, they can be limiting when it comes to aiming for headshots. BlueStacks offers a solution by allowing you to play Free Fire on a larger PC or laptop screen, enhancing your aiming efficiency. Here are some key features of BlueStacks that can help improve your headshot accuracy:

  • Keyboard and Mouse Support: BlueStacks enables you to map controls to your keyboard and mouse, providing greater accuracy and ease of aiming compared to touch controls. You can assign specific keys for movement, aiming, and shooting, mimicking a PC gaming setup.
  • Customizable Key Mapping: The built-in key mapping feature allows you to customize controls to your liking. For headshots, you can assign the fire button to the mouse for smoother drag shots and quicker reaction times.
  • Enhanced Graphics and Performance: With BlueStacks, you can set the graphics to the highest settings without worrying about device overheating or lag. This ensures a smoother gameplay experience, making it easier to focus on precise aiming.
  • Improved Sensitivity Settings: BlueStacks offers fine-tuned sensitivity adjustments, giving you better control for drag shots and scoped headshots.

By leveraging BlueStacks, players can enjoy Free Fire on a larger screen with the precision of a keyboard and mouse, significantly enhancing their gaming experience.
